Holy Grail Trip
1-4 Player Competetive RPG
Introduction
Hey guys, I had a strange idea for a competetive role play multiplayer game. The whole map is set up as a labyrinth. Each player can choose one of 4 heroes and one of 3 spells, but each hero has the "Blink" ability - to speed up the game. The whole game takes about 15 to 30 minutes. I didn't want it to be much longer since the quests are very trivial. There are 4 questgivers: The manager, artist, dealer and musician. Each needs 3 items. If you collect at least 9 items you can buy the holy grail trip at the goa shop and win the game
The environment is set up around a goa party.

Story Description
You are with your friends at a goa party, and would like to have the ultimate trip, called the holy grail trip. But since you're low on cash, you have to get the money first. By helping out some guys from the goa, you can afford yourself the so called holy grail trip at the goa shop and win the game. The fastest wins!
Game Features
- 4 Different Heroes
- 3 optional spells
- Goa as safe place to rest and buy necessary items (and listen to goa music)
- Police or Mafia flying around on helicopters and busting/killing you for illegal activites!
- Hidden treasures all around the map!
- Personal chest at the goa to store items
